Q
What is a Cisco Compatible QSFP28 transceiver?
A
A Cisco Compatible QSFP28 transceiver is a hot-swappable, MSA-compliant 4-lane optical module that delivers 100 Gbps connectivity in Cisco switches, routers, and servers.
Q
What data rates does Cisco Compatible QSFP28 support?
A
Cisco Compatible QSFP28 modules support data rates up to 100 Gbps per port, using four 25 Gbps lanes to meet high-performance networking requirements.
Q
What distances can Cisco Compatible QSFP28 modules cover?
A
Multimode Cisco Compatible QSFP28 modules cover 100 m to 2 km, while single-mode variants extend reach up to 40 km over single-mode fiber.
Q
Which fiber types are supported by Cisco Compatible QSFP28?
A
They support OM3/OM4 multimode fiber for short-reach links and single-mode fiber (SMF) for long-haul connections.
Q
Are Cisco Compatible QSFP28 modules hot-swappable?
A
Yes, Cisco Compatible QSFP28 transceivers are hot-swappable, allowing insertion and removal without powering down the host device.
Q
Which Cisco platforms support Cisco Compatible QSFP28?
A
They are fully compatible with Cisco Nexus, Catalyst, and UCS series switches and routers that feature QSFP28 ports.
Q
Are Cisco Compatible QSFP28 modules MSA compliant?
A
Yes, Cisco Compatible QSFP28 modules adhere to Multi-Source Agreement (MSA) specifications and SFF-8636 standards for interoperability.
Q
Do Cisco Compatible QSFP28 modules support Digital Diagnostics Monitoring (DDM)?
A
Yes, all Cisco Compatible QSFP28 modules include DDM/DOM functionality for real-time monitoring of optical power, temperature, and voltage.
Q
What wavelengths are available in Cisco Compatible QSFP28 transceivers?
A
Multimode modules operate at 850 nm, while single-mode versions use 1310 nm or tuned DWDM wavelengths for long-reach applications.
Q
Can Cisco Compatible QSFP28 modules interoperate with Cisco OEM transceivers?
A
Yes, Cisco Compatible QSFP28 modules interoperate seamlessly with Cisco OEM and certified third-party optics on supported platforms.
Q
What is the typical power consumption of Cisco Compatible QSFP28 modules?
A
Typical power consumption ranges from 2.5 W to 4.5 W per module, depending on optical reach and form-factor.

Q
How can I troubleshoot a Cisco Compatible QSFP28 link issue?
A
Check physical connections, review DDM readings for power and temperature, verify port configuration, and swap modules or cables to isolate the fault.
